For the past five years, I have been deeply immersed in the art of leatherworking. I taught myself the craft from the ground up, experimenting with different techniques and types of leather. The material that captured my heart the most is Pueblo leather—a truly unique leather known for its rich texture and beautiful patina that develops over time. Because of these qualities, it is highly valued by leather artisans around the world.
Design is a huge part of my process. Each product begins as an idea, which slowly evolves through sketches, digital design, and prototypes. It often takes many iterations to refine every detail, but that is where the magic happens. The reward is a final product that feels right—simple, functional, and made to age beautifully with everyday use.
